River otters eat fish, crayfish, frogs, and occasionally young muskrats. The hundreds of bird species visible in summer have dwindled to a few dozen; among them are the mountain and black-capped chickadee, red-breasted nuthatch, Townsends solitaire, gray jay, and Clarks nutcracker.
